Souleigh ✨ Souleigh ✨
4年前
PHP对时间轮算法的简单实现
什么是时间轮算法?把任务放到它需要被执行的时刻,然后等待时针转到这个时刻,取出该时刻的任务,执行并将任务从该时刻删除(消费)。解决了什么问题?以商品为例,如何实现商品的过保质期自动失效?1:我们可以每分钟执行一个定时任务,扫描全表过期时间大于当前时间的商品,进行失效处理。(当然,也可以将该任务细化成秒级的)2:商品添加时,将该商品的
Souleigh ✨ Souleigh ✨
4年前
尤雨溪:TypeScript不会取代JavaScript
近日,Evrone与Vue.js的作者尤雨溪进行了一次访谈,了解他对于无后端与全栈方法、以及Vue.js适用场景的看法,还有他本人如何在工作与生活之间取得平衡。记者:嗨Evan,很荣幸你能接受我们的访谈。那就先从一个简单的问题开始:您的全职工作岗位是由Patreon资助的,大多数人恐怕都没有这样的机会。您能聊聊怎样在工作与生活之间找到
阿里内部核心Java进阶手册:2021年最新Java面试经历
阿里P8级架构师核心理论落地篇1.再造淘宝,贯穿全系,阿里团队代码落地,详细每个版本迭代,拒绝23个月PPT架构师2.再造淘宝之咚宝技术支撑完整搭建DevOps3.再造淘宝之咚宝统一规则代码规范落地解析4.再造淘宝之咚宝搭建基础服务5.再造淘宝之咚宝构建step01用户中心6.再造淘宝之咚宝构建step02商品中心7.再造淘宝
Wesley13 Wesley13
3年前
QQ群提问没人理?别急,来点“分答”吧!
各位小伙伴,你是不是加了无数个学习UI的QQ群?但是每当打开这些QQ群,看到无数信息流扑面而过,你的问题瞬间淹没在汪洋大海中,是不是有点小小的失望呢?你是不是还在抱怨,QQ群压根学不到东西好吗?你是不是已经全luo跪求,仍然没有人回答你的问题?你是不是已经愤而退出QQ群?如果你想更快速有效的学习,QQ群显然并不是一个很好的
Stella981 Stella981
3年前
Linux 使用cp命令的错误
昨天维护的编译软件出了一个奇怪的问题,功能大概是这样的:1、下载资源和代码;2、编译;3、将需要打包的文件复制到临时目录打包。后来由于新需求,修改了一下功能,在复制到临时目录之前还有回去一些资源到临时目录:2.5、下载三方资源到临时目录。增加此功能后错误就出现了,复制的临时目录的结构全乱了,比如:java/bin应复制到temp/
Wesley13 Wesley13
3年前
Hibernate常见知识汇总
1.在数据库中条件查询速度很慢的时候,如何优化?1.建索引2.减少表之间的关联3.优化sql,尽量让sql很快定位数据,不要让sql做全表查询,应该走索引,把数据量大的表排在前面4.简化查询字段,没用的字段不要,已经对返回结果的控制,尽量返回少量数据2.在Hibernate中进行多表查询,每个表中各取几个字段,也就是说查询出来的结果
飞速成功案例 | MES系统升级重构,覆盖业务流程各场景功能
1个系统解决所有业务问题覆盖业务流程各场景功能(图片来源于:百度)筑友集团定位为智慧建筑整体解决方案服务商,旨在以EMPC为核心产品,打造涵盖研发、设计、PC构件、装备、施工、新材、装饰、园林、智能家居等业务的全生态链优势企业。筑友集团已在全国22省、45城布局智能化数字工厂,全球首创的EMPC业务模式得到社会和客户广泛认可,目前已服务全国项目600万㎡,工
京东云开发者 京东云开发者
5个月前
硅基流动+Cherry Studio‘0天然全科技’快速搭建DeepSeek满血版
作者:京东物流刘红妍一、前言近期DeepSeek如此火爆,全民跃跃欲试,奈何频繁的【服务器繁忙,请稍后再试】,让探索的路上体验不佳。前驱力量紧接着发布【如何本地化部署DeepSeek】的指导,尝试过程中苦于自己电脑的硬件条件,运行7B/14B的结果确实让人
京东云开发者 京东云开发者
5个月前
硅基流动+Cherry Studio‘0天然全科技’快速搭建DeepSeek满血版
作者:京东物流冯志文本文参考网上资料学习,IDEA接入DeepSeek私有化部署DeepSeekDify搭建智能助手接入微信(个人电脑Windows和mac都可以安装),手把手保姆级教程。一、IDEA接入DeepSeek1)首先IDEA下载安装Con
贾蔷 贾蔷
1个月前
牛客12576题全解析:动态规划+质因数分解解决跳跃问题
一、题目解读牛客12576题是一道经典的算法题,要求给定起点N和终点M,求解从N到M的最少跳跃次数。题目考察的核心在于路径优化与动态规划思想,需结合数论中的质因数分解技巧,通过合理设计算法降低时间复杂度,避免暴力枚举的指数级耗时。二、解题思路采用“动态规划